Watsonville Community Hospital owners abruptly ousted
WATSONVILLE—The company that purchased Watsonville Community Hospital two years ago—Los Angeles-based Halsen Healthcare—has been removed from a leadership role as of Jan. 18.
Los Angeles-based Prospect Medical Holdings will now run the hospital on an interim basis. The announcement came Monday via an email to...

Pedestrian killed in early morning Watsonville collision
WATSONVILLE—A Watsonville man died early Tuesday morning when he was struck by a car as he walked along West Beach Street.
Watsonville Police spokeswoman Michelle Pulido said the 42-year-old victim was walking partially in the westbound lane in front of Big Creek Lumber, 1400 W....

PVUSD schools to close for two weeks, teachers to stay home
WATSONVILLE—The Pajaro Valley Unified School District Board of Trustees in an emergency meeting Saturday unanimously approved a plan to close all district schools for two weeks, and allow most employees to work from home.
Essential staff will provide services such as food, custodial and technology,...
